Black Ginger (Kaempferia parviflora): 5 Science-Backed Health Benefits, Uses & Safety

Black Ginger

Black Ginger (Kaempferia parviflora), has been used in traditional Thai medicine for centuries to promote vitality, physical endurance, healthy aging, and overall wellness.

In recent years, scientific interest in Black Ginger has increased considerably due to its unique phytochemical profile, particularly its abundance of polymethoxyflavones (PMFs), including 5,7-dimethoxyflavone and 5,7,4′-trimethoxyflavone, which are believed to contribute to many of its biological activities.

Modern pharmacological studies suggest that Black Ginger possesses antioxidant, anti-inflammatory, metabolic, and vasodilatory properties, making it a promising herbal ingredient for functional foods and dietary supplements.

1. May Improve Energy Levels and Physical Performance

One of the most widely recognized benefits of Black Ginger is its potential to enhance physical performance and reduce fatigue. Traditionally, it has been consumed by athletes and physically active individuals to improve stamina and endurance.

Research suggests that polymethoxyflavones found in Black Ginger may stimulate energy metabolism by activating AMP-activated protein kinase (AMPK), a key regulator of cellular energy production. Enhanced mitochondrial function and improved glucose utilization may contribute to increased endurance during physical activity (1).

Several human studies have also reported improvements in grip strength, walking performance, and overall physical fitness among older adults receiving Black Ginger supplementation. Wattanathorn et al. observed improvements in physical fitness and muscular endurance following regular supplementation, suggesting potential benefits for maintaining mobility in aging populations (2).

Although these findings are promising, Black Ginger should not be considered a substitute for regular exercise, balanced nutrition, and adequate recovery.

2. Supports Healthy Blood Circulation

Healthy circulation is essential for delivering oxygen and nutrients throughout the body. Black Ginger has attracted scientific attention for its ability to support vascular function through enhanced nitric oxide production.

Experimental studies indicate that Black Ginger extracts promote endothelial nitric oxide synthase (eNOS) activity, leading to increased nitric oxide availability. Nitric oxide relaxes blood vessels, improves vascular flexibility, and promotes healthy blood flow (3).

Improved circulation may help support exercise performance, tissue oxygenation, and overall cardiovascular wellness. Some preliminary clinical studies have also suggested improvements in peripheral blood flow after Black Ginger supplementation.

However, individuals taking medications that affect blood pressure or circulation should consult a healthcare professional before using Black Ginger supplements.

3. Rich Source of Antioxidants

Oxidative stress contributes to aging and numerous chronic diseases, including cardiovascular disorders, diabetes, and neurodegenerative conditions. Black Ginger contains several potent antioxidant compounds that help neutralize free radicals.

The major polymethoxyflavones exhibit significant antioxidant activity by reducing oxidative damage and supporting endogenous antioxidant defense systems such as superoxide dismutase (SOD) and glutathione peroxidase (GPx) (4).

Laboratory studies have demonstrated that Black Ginger extract reduces lipid peroxidation, inhibits reactive oxygen species (ROS) generation, and protects cellular structures against oxidative injury.

Because oxidative stress plays a role in multiple chronic conditions, the antioxidant properties of Black Ginger may contribute to overall healthy aging when combined with a balanced diet rich in fruits and vegetables.

4. May Support Healthy Metabolic Function

Emerging evidence suggests that Black Ginger may help support normal metabolic health. Experimental studies indicate that its bioactive compounds may influence glucose metabolism, lipid metabolism, and energy expenditure.

Animal studies have shown improvements in insulin sensitivity, reduced fat accumulation, and enhanced fatty acid oxidation following Black Ginger supplementation. These effects are believed to occur through activation of AMPK pathways and modulation of genes involved in lipid metabolism (5).

Some preliminary human research has also reported modest reductions in body fat percentage and improvements in metabolic markers among overweight individuals.

Although these findings are encouraging, Black Ginger should not be viewed as a treatment for obesity or diabetes. Lifestyle modifications, including healthy eating and regular physical activity, remain the cornerstone of metabolic health.

5. May Support Cognitive Function During Aging

Healthy brain function depends on adequate blood flow, reduced oxidative stress, and protection of neurons from inflammation. Black Ginger has demonstrated neuroprotective properties in several experimental studies.

Animal research suggests that Black Ginger extract may improve learning and memory by reducing oxidative damage, suppressing neuroinflammation, and enhancing cerebral blood circulation. Wattanathorn et al. reported improvements in memory performance in aged animal models receiving Black Ginger extract (2).

Its antioxidant and anti-inflammatory activities may help protect neuronal cells against age-related decline. Researchers have also proposed that improved endothelial function may increase cerebral blood flow, potentially supporting cognitive performance.

Nevertheless, evidence from large-scale human clinical trials remains limited. More rigorous studies are needed before definitive conclusions can be drawn regarding its role in cognitive health.

How Black Ginger Works

The biological activities of Black Ginger are largely attributed to its polymethoxyflavones, which influence several molecular pathways. These compounds may activate AMPK, enhance nitric oxide production, reduce inflammatory cytokines, inhibit oxidative stress, and improve mitochondrial function. Together, these mechanisms contribute to improved energy metabolism, vascular health, antioxidant defense, and cellular protection.

Safety and Dosage

Human clinical studies generally report that standardized Black Ginger extracts are well tolerated when consumed at recommended doses. Commercial supplements commonly provide between 90 and 180 mg of standardized extract daily, although dosages vary depending on product formulation and extract concentration.

Possible mild side effects may include digestive discomfort or stomach upset in sensitive individuals.

Pregnant or breastfeeding women, individuals taking blood-thinning medications, antihypertensive drugs, or those with chronic medical conditions should consult a healthcare professional before using Black Ginger supplements.

Selecting products that are standardized for polymethoxyflavone content and manufactured under Good Manufacturing Practices (GMP) can help ensure product quality and consistency.

The Bottom Line

Black Ginger (Kaempferia parviflora) is an increasingly popular botanical with growing scientific support for its role in promoting overall wellness. Current evidence suggests that it may improve energy production, support physical performance, promote healthy blood circulation, provide antioxidant protection, support metabolic health, and contribute to healthy cognitive function. These benefits are largely attributed to its unique polymethoxyflavone compounds, which exhibit antioxidant, anti-inflammatory, and vasodilatory activities.
